3.3.2.6. Replacing compressor
PRELIMINARY ACTIONS
1. Switch off the Daikin unit via the user interface.
2. Switch off the Daikin unit with the field supplied circuit breaker.
3. Remove plate work when required (refer to
4. Recover the refrigerant (refer to
"Refrigerant repair procedures" on page 61
).
5. Remove the compressor jacket.
6. Remove the lower propeller fan (refer to
"Replacing propeller fan blade assembly" on page 99
7. Connect a nitrogen hose to the outdoor suction service port.
8. Attach a hose with core-depressor to allow the release of the nitrogen.
PROCEDURE
Removal
1. Cut the 2 tie wraps that fix the power and communication wires to the stop valve mounting plate.
2. Loosen and remove the 4 screws (1) that fix the stop valves.
3. Loosen and remove the 2 screws (2) that fix the stop valve mounting plate (3).
4. Lift and remove the stop valve mounting plate (3).
